Document Summary

Prosocial behavior : behavior that intends to help or benefit someone. Proximity : geographic nearness; is friendship"s most powerful predictor. proximity provides opportunities for aggression, but much more often it breeds liking. Passionate love : an aroused state of intense positive absorption in another, usually present at the beginning of a love relationship. Self-disclosure : the act of revealing intimate aspects of oneself to others. Altruism : unselfish regard for the welfare of others. Social exchange theory : refers to the theory that our social behavior is an exchange process, the aim of which is to maximize benefits and minimize costs. Social-responsibility norm : expectation that people will help those needing their help. Social trap : situation in which the conflicting parties, by each pursuing their self-interest rather than the good of the group, become caught in mutually destructive behavior.
